Practice Schedule and Cognitive Style Interaction in Learning a Maze Task OTTO JELSMA and JULES
In the present study the effects of contextual interference on the retention and transfer performance of reflectives and impulsives on a maze task were studied. Forty-seven subjects were randomly assigned to either a high contextual interference group or to a low contextual interference group. متن کاملBehavioral despair during a water maze learning task in mice.
In the case of mice, when the difficulty of a water maze learning task is increased, some animals gradually cease to swim, abandon adaptive learning, and become immobile. We trained 99 male C57BL/6N mice in a pool containing a hidden platform. The pool was surrounded by white featureless walls, and almost all external cues were removed. Running head: PRACTICE SCHEDULE AND CRITICAL THINKING PROMPTS The Effects of Practice Schedule and Critical Thinking Prompts on Learning and Transfer of a Complex Judgment Task
Many instructional strategies that appear to improve learners’ performance during training, may not realize adequate post test performance or transfer to a job. And the converse has been found true as well: instructional strategies that appear to slow the learner’s progress during training often lead to better post-training or transfer performance.
